Psalter-Hours
France, Bourges, 1455-1460
MS M.67 fol. 49r

See more information »

Psalm 027 (Vulg., 026).
David, crowned, wearing mantle with ermine-lined collar and money purse hanging from waist, kneels beside harp on ground, with left hand pointing to eye with left hand, and looks toward God, with raised right hand in blessing, and globe in left hand, surrounded by red angels in arc of heaven, emitting rays.
Scene in landscape setting within arched gold frame surrounded by foliate border.
